Re-viewing Pompeian domestic space through combined virtual reality-based eye tracking and 3D GIS
(2022) In Antiquity 96(386). p.479-486- Abstract
- This article presents an innovative methodology in which virtual reality-based eye-tracking techniques and 3D Geographical Information Systems are employed to record and measure human visual attention within the virtually reconstructed space of a Pompeian house.
